Face-to-Face Beats Virtual for Important Meetings

From M&IT: The vast majority (87 per cent) of CEOs of firmly believe that technology will never replace the value of strategically important face-to-face meetings, according to new research. The survey from flexible workspace provider International Workplace Group highlights how business executives are prioritising strategically important meetings for corporate spend. Informa Launches Asia-Pacific MICE Event in Hong Kong in 2025

From TSNN: Organized by Informa Markets with Informa Connect as co-organizer, Connect Marketplace Hong Kong is launching March 19-21, 2025, at AsiaWorld-Expo. The inaugural Asia Pacific event for the Meetings, Incentives, Conferences, and Events (MICE) community marks the debut of Connect Marketplace in Asia, aiming to elevate experiences and shape the future of the industry….

Antwerp Facilitates Knowledge Exchange, Innovation and Progress

From Meetings International: The Belgian city of Antwerp has been a central trading hub for centuries and is home to Europe’s second-largest port. It is also the capital of the diamond trade and the world’s second-largest petrochemical cluster.
